About Jomblang Cave
Jomblang cave is a vertical cave with a forest inside the cave. The cave was formed by a natural geological process when the soil and all vegetations on it crumbled some thousands years ago. The cave has a forest and also water as Kalisuci river flows at the bottom of the cave.

About Caving adventure in Yogyakarta
One of the most adventurous activities I have done in Indonesia is the caving adventure in Jomblang cave. The caving adventure is operated by a local operator Jomblang Cave Tours and Travels. It is surely for the travelers who seek adventures as you can go inside a cave and explore the wild side of the cave. The adventure seekers are harnessed with ropes and safety gear where they abseil into the cave for about 90 metres.
- Wear sturdy and comfortable shoes for the activity.

After entering the cave, you can walk around and at a distance of just 500 metres from the drop point are some of the spectacular photographic points, where the light plays hide and seek inside the cave.

Booking and cost
The cave is open for the activity only over the weekends between 7 AM and 7 PM. It is best to talk to one of the local taxi drivers in Yogyakarta as they are aware of the activity and can take you to the booking place, which is the entrance of Jomblang cave.
- Try to reach the Jomblang cave early as only limited people are allowed inside the cave.
The caving adventure cost around Indonesian Rupees 450000 per person that includes the transportation to the cave, the caving adventure and the guide charges.
- Ensure to carry cash as cash is the only mode of payment.
How to get to Jomblang Cave?
Driving
The best way to reach Jomblang Cave is by a car or two wheeler. Located in Gunungkidul Regency of Yogyakarta region, the distance between Yogyakarta city and the cave is around 50 kilometres and the journey by road takes about 1 hour 20 minutes.
Public transport
Unfortunately, there is no public transportation to Jomblang Cave and the only way to get to the cave is by driving or hiring a taxi.
